#55e33d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#55e33d is composed of 33.3% red, 89%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 73.1%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 111.3 degrees, a saturation of 74.8% and a lightness of 56.5%. #55e33d color hex could be obtained by blending #aaff7a with #00c700.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#55e33d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030c02 is the darkest color, while #fafefa is the lightest one.

Tones of #55e33d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c968a is the less saturated color, while #43fd23 is the most saturated one.
